Automation & Controls Technician Job Summary

Under general supervision of the Facilities Maintenance Automation Manager, the automation technician will provide technical support for the electrical and automation systems of the plant. Responsible for maintaining the hardware and software process control systems including associated instrumentation. Issue, maintain, and update related documentation. Administer upgrades, modifications, and new installations to maintain and increase operational efficiency of the plant processes. This position has no supervisory responsibilities.

  • Conduct estimation, planning and execution of maintenance and improvement process projects
  • Develop and implement project descriptions, plans timelines, resources requirements, costs and other associated project details
  • Provide primary technical support and troubleshooting to maintain the existing electrical and automation systems
  • Provide corrective measures to existing electrical and automation systems for maximum reliability and up-time
  • Assist with maintenance project scope development and execution by conveying technical experiences and opinions
  • Facilitate task or project work through effective communication
  • Solicit plant associates' experiences and opinions for project execution and development
  • Ensure that guidelines and procedures are followed for software changes, including written management approval, clear change definition
  • Ensure that process descriptions P&IDs and other documentation are updated when a change is implemented

  • Associate's degree that relates to the power, control or electro-mechanical
  • 2 years of power control, or electro-mechanical technical experience in a related industrial field

  • Experience with running small projects, troubleshooting industrial/process control systems (PLCs, component operator interfaces, and HMIs)
  • All aspects of electronics/electricity, power/control voltages, instrumentation, electro-pneumatic control devices, and Variable Frequency Drives (VFD)
  • Familiarity with Ethernet, Rockwell Software, and RS Logix 5/500/5000 processors
  • Additional experience with Siemens 500, Safety Circuits, and Systems PLC interfacing
